Sometimes the cheaper price comes at the cost of service so it ends up not being the best deal after all. As already noted, I make it a point to call and see if the item is in stock before I place an online order as I have experienced cases where the item shows in stock on the order form but the phone call says they are out of stock.

The reason some of these online "dealers" can keep their prices so low is that they have no overhead (don't keep anything in stock on premise). They count on being able to place an order with their distributor and then ship it to you, all takes time.

Another problem with a process like this is that distributors often require a minimum order before they ship to the "dealer".
